This is a great photo, beautiful detail, dead on contrast, the "subject" being the drops of water perfectly centered in the focal plane. The lighting is great on this, Did you light with a speed light?
What is your post processing process?
actually i did use speeds light my sony hvf58 combined with an orange juice carton and an old white plastic yoghurt wrapping for diffusing the light at the end to get the light where i wanted it to be . These days i use the Pringles diffuser in different lenght for different lenses http://www.wikihow.com/Make-a-Pringles-Can-Macro-Diffuser
